While some folks may view spiders as dangerous or creepy creatures to be destroyed, a closer look reveals one of nature’s most unique and beneficial animals. From the itsy bitsy to the giant (see Carolina wolf spider), North Carolina is home to a vast array of arachnids.

Your spidey sense may be tingling, but don’t let it send the wrong signal! The vast majority are friendly neighborhood spiders doing all of us a service, and chances are good you’ve been living peacefully alongside spiders for some time. As with all things in nature, caution is still needed in certain situations, as there are poisonous spiders in North Carolina whose bites can be problematic.
